Contestants in the Run-and-Bike-a-thon run for a specified length of time, then bike for a specified length of time. Jason ran at an average speed of 5.8 mi/h and biked at an average speed of 20.2 mi/h, going a total of 14.6 miles. Seth ran at an average speed of 11.6 mi/h and biked at an average speed of 18.8 mi/h, going a total of 17 miles. For how long do contestants run and for how long do they bike? Round to the nearest hundredth if necessary.
